Heroes in Medicine to be Honored at Awards Luncheon

Palm Beach County Medical Society Services recently announced its finalists for the 2011 Heroes in Medicine Awards. Finalists will be recognized at the “Eighth Annual Heroes in Medicine Awards Luncheon,” to be held on May 11 at 11 a.m. at the Kravis Center in West Palm Beach.

Award recipients in various categories will be announced at the luncheon, which is made
possible by the grand benefactor, Rendina.

“This year’s finalists are an incredible group of people who have done so much for this community and beyond,” said chairwoman Sally D. Chester. “They are all truly heroes.”

Proceeds from the “Heroes in Medicine” will benefit Project Access, a community-based program to increase access to healthcare for the uninsured. The event is sponsored by the presenting enefactor, Rendina; grand benefactor, JFK Medical Center Medical Staff; benefactor, JFK Medical Center, and South Florida Hospital News.
